Build vs Buy: Liner Shipping Operations Software for Carriers and NVOCCs
Buy if you are a feeder operator or NVOCC on one or two lanes with simple documentation and few filing jurisdictions. Softship or CargoSmart will run that properly.

Build once slot allocation against partner agreements is managed in a planner's spreadsheet, or the same cargo details are keyed into two systems on one rotation.
Where the packaged liner systems are the correct answer
Softship and CargoSmart were built by people who understand the trade, and that matters more in this category than in almost any other. A liner operating system has to know that a booking becomes shipping instructions, which become a bill of lading, which becomes a manifest line filed with a customs authority, which becomes a freight invoice, and that all of them must describe the same cargo in the same container under the same seal. Nobody arrives at that model from a standing start.
If your service structure is conventional, your trade lanes are few and your documentation is straightforward, buying is the sensible choice and your competitive advantage lies in your schedule reliability and your rates rather than in your booking screen. A feeder operator running fixed rotations for a handful of principals, or an NVOCC moving a few hundred containers a month, gets a working operating system without funding a multi year programme.
There is a second buying case that has nothing to do with volume. If your operations team is small and your technical capacity is one person, a packaged system means regulatory updates, message standard changes and security patching arrive as vendor work rather than as recruitment. That constraint decides the question for many carriers regardless of what the cost model says.
The commercial arrangements that force a build
The first is slot allocation against partner agreements. Vessel sharing arrangements and slot swaps carry terms specific to each agreement: how many slots you control per port pair, how usage is counted, how settlement works. That logic is where a carrier makes or loses money on a sailing, and it is precisely the area where packaged configuration runs out. The symptom is unmistakable. The packaged system holds the bookings while a planner keeps the real allocation in a spreadsheet beside it, and at that point the system is no longer running the business.
The second is rating. Contract rates, spot quotes and surcharge families that apply by trade, commodity and equipment type multiply as you grow, and effective dating has to sit on all of them. Most carrier invoice disputes are not fraud. They are surcharge applicability arguments nobody can settle because the rate in force at booking time cannot be reconstructed. If your team corrects surcharges on invoices by hand every month, that is the cost of a model your software cannot express.
The third is filing breadth. Every jurisdiction on a rotation has its own required fields, deadlines relative to departure or arrival, transmission method and amendment flow, and those rules change on the authority's schedule rather than the vendor's. Once you file into several regimes, you want the rules held as configuration with effective dates so a change is data rather than a release, and so last year's filings remain reproducible as they were made.
The fourth is equipment. Containers are a circulating fleet with a position, a condition, a lease status and a repositioning cost, not stock. A booking is acceptable when there is space on the vessel and a suitable box at a depot within trucking distance of the shipper on the right day. Systems that treat equipment as an attribute of a booking cannot answer that, which is why certain bookings are quietly unprofitable.
What both routes cost, lane by lane
Packaged liner systems price on licence plus implementation plus support, and the implementation scales with how far your service structure sits from the vendor's defaults. Ask for a written boundary between configuration and change request before signing, because that line is where the real number lives, and it is drawn differently by every vendor.
A custom first release covering the voyage and allocation model, booking capture, equipment inventory and bill of lading issuance runs roughly $110,000 to $220,000 and ships in 16 to 22 weeks. A full platform adding multi jurisdiction manifest filing, dangerous goods workflow, tariff and surcharge rating with invoicing, demurrage and detention calculation and partner messaging runs $320,000 to $700,000 phased over 10 to 16 months. Maintenance runs 15 to 20 percent of build cost a year, weighted heavily toward filing rules and partner message formats.
Jurisdiction count drives price harder than container volume in either route, because each filing regime is separate analysis with its own test cycle. Partner agreement count comes second, since each slot arrangement has its own settlement terms. Terminal and depot integrations come third and are the least predictable, because they vary by port and are rarely uniform even inside one country.
The costs that appear at the second port
The one worth knowing before you scope anything: a manifest penalty almost never attaches to the cargo. It attaches to timing and to data consistency. A filing made after the deadline, or one where the description, weight or party details differ from the bill of lading, produces a fine and often a hold at discharge, even when everything about the shipment is legitimate. That means the expensive failure mode is a mismatch between two documents your own systems produced, which is a modelling problem rather than an operational one.
The second is amendment history. A corrected bill of lading is not a replaced record. It is a legal instrument whose prior state matters, and any system that handles a correction by editing the row has thrown away the thing a bank or a court will eventually ask for. Retrofitting versioning after go live is far more expensive than specifying it, and packaged systems differ considerably in how seriously they take it.
The third is demurrage and detention, which sounds like arithmetic and is not. Free time depends on the contract, the equipment type, the terminal, local holidays and sometimes on a concession a sales manager granted verbally. The calculation is trivial once the event history is trustworthy, so the actual work is event capture, correction and a dispute path. Budget for the dispute path.
The fourth is dangerous goods, which carriers repeatedly treat as a flag on a booking rather than as a workflow. Declaration data, segregation constraints and approval have to be settled before the booking is confirmed, then carried through to the stowage instruction so the vessel planner sees exactly the facts you accepted. When that chain breaks, loading stops at the quayside, and the cost of an hour of stopped loading is a number your operations director can quote from memory.
The fifth is partner data quality. Bookings, container status, gate events and stowage data arrive as structured messages from carriers, terminals and depots, and their quality varies enormously. Build ingestion with an exception queue and a named owner, because silent rejection is how a carrier discovers at the terminal gate that a container it believed was booked exists in nobody's system.
The duplicate keying test
Spend one rotation watching where data is typed. Pick a single voyage and follow twenty bookings from acceptance through documentation, filing and invoicing. Every time a person keys a cargo description, a weight, a party name or a container number into a second system, write it down with the reason. Then do the same for allocation: note every capacity decision made outside the software.
Duplicate keying is the reliable early symptom, and the count tells you which route you are on. Zero or one instance across twenty bookings means your packaged system is carrying its weight and the answer is to buy or stay. Repeated keying, particularly into a spreadsheet that a planner or an agent maintains, means the model in your software no longer matches the business, and every one of those transcriptions is a future mismatch penalty waiting for the right rotation.
Then ask a second question with a documented answer. Has a filing penalty in the last year traced back to a data mismatch rather than to a person's mistake. If yes, the gap is structural, and no amount of process discipline closes it. If your penalties trace to genuine human error under time pressure, better training and earlier cut offs may be cheaper than any software decision.
A first lane, then a decision
Whichever way you lean, do not scope the whole network. Take one trade lane end to end, with every document and every filing working properly on a single rotation, and treat that as the unit of evaluation. The model learned on the first lane makes the second materially cheaper, and it also exposes whether a packaged product genuinely fits before you have committed the whole business to it.
When you evaluate a developer, ask how a rolled container propagates. When a box misses a sailing, allocation, documentation, filings, invoicing and equipment position all change, and anyone who has built this will draw that cascade immediately while anyone who has not will describe a status update. Then ask how filing rules are maintained, and listen for configuration with effective dates and a test harness per jurisdiction rather than a code release each time an authority adjusts a field.
Settle ownership before kickoff. You should hold the repository, the cloud accounts and the unrestricted right to hire another firm, which for a system that issues bills of lading and files manifests is a continuity question rather than a commercial preference.

Why do manifest filings generate penalties when the cargo is legitimate?
Because the penalty usually attaches to timing and data consistency rather than to the cargo itself. A filing submitted after the deadline, or one where description, weight or party details differ from the bill of lading, triggers a fine and often a hold at discharge. Generating filings from the same records that produced the bill of lading removes the entire mismatch class of failure.

Can we migrate historical bookings and documents into a new system?
Yes, though the useful target is narrower than people expect. Move open and recent voyages fully, and archive older records in a searchable form rather than reprocessing them through a new model. Bills of lading in particular carry amendment history that rarely survives an export cleanly, so keep the original system readable for as long as your document retention obligations require.
